[ Impact ]

 * Low, this brings back a legacy feature now disabled in Mesa by
default, just a packaging change

[ Test Plan ]

 * Just the usual Mesa testing
 * But additionally confirm `eglinfo` reports EGL_WL_bind_wayland_display:

```
$ eglinfo -p surfaceless | grep EGL_WL
    EGL_WL_bind_wayland_display
```

[ Where problems could occur ]

 * Just a configuration change in Mesa, unlikely to cause issues

[ Other Info ]

 * Source of the issue: WPE Webkit requires this extension still:
   https://github.com/Igalia/cog/issues/776

 * And that breaks downstream snaps:
   https://github.com/canonical/mesa-2404/issues/127
